Description
These photographs document the daily lives of farmworkers and their families in the San Joaquin Valley. The San Joaquin Valley, the most productive agricultural area in the world, rural poverty is endemic. This series of photographs presents the complex reality of Farmworkers, farm labors, and their families while the height of Covid-19 Pandemic as well as heat dome cries that affect their work.
